What is a Computer Engineer & What Do They Do?

WebFeb 19, 2024 · Computer engineers have the necessary skills to work with hardware components and know programming languages. They also have basic knowledge of software design, coding, software development, and software debugging fundamentals and expert knowledge in the best practices of computer engineering. WebMar 30, 2012 · And, yes, mechanical engineers do a significant amount of computer programming, which they use as a tool to predict things like how fast our stomach dissolves medication, how to design better airplane wings, and how to make cars that require less fuel.
